I was wondering when you select the "fixed rise by 2100" option when is the start date for this rise?  Is it the DEM date, the NWI date, the year 2000, or something else?  Also, if SLAMM is using the IPCC curves to calculate this, does it shift that curve at all or just start in on the IPCC curve at the start date that you give it.

Sorry about the delay in response.  Like the IPCC scenarios all SLR scenarios start in the year 1990 in SLAMM.  Curves are not shifted horizontally.  Therefore if you started your scenario in 2010 it would assume that the SLR predicted from 1990 to 2010 had already occurred and start adding SLR at that point.
